To make some of your own, you're going to need: - Pumpkin Seeds (washed and dried) - A cup or bowl that you don't mind using with food coloring - Water - Vinegar - Food Coloring In your cup (or bowl), mix 1/2 cup of cold water with 1 1/2 tablespoons of vinegar and add a few drops of food coloring until you have your desired color. SUGAR COOKIES: TIPS & TOOLS Paste Food Coloring While you can use grocery store food coloring, you'll have more options and better results with the paste colors found at specialty bakery supply stores.
